    I'd do 3.5 stars if it let me. Wife and I saw this spot on an instagram reel so we thought we'd check it out. We showed up at 5:30 on a Friday night and were the only two people in the place for quite a while. We ordered the Tuscany pizza and chicken wings. It seemed like the owner maybe was the one working alone, his service was great for being the only one there. We received our pizza and were about halfway done when our wings showed up. Two other tables came in and the DoorDash/Grubhub machine kept going off. He was doing his best to make sure everything got taken care of. We weren't in a hurry so it wasn't a big deal to us but I could see how some might get annoyed as I read in other reviews. The pizza was good, the wings were ok. The space itself is nice. I'd go again but it wouldn't be my first choice.

    Randomly picked a non-chain pizza place and Eni's was the winner. Surprisingly they are a hybrid pizzeria & Mexican joint. Super clean! Friendly staff! Super yummy food! Of course we tried the brick oven cooked pizza, but I did choose an infusion by getting the Pastor Pizza. Definitely coming back to try the Mexican meals too.

    Really enjoyed ourselves at Eni's. The service was great. Very friendly and attentive. The Eni's salad was good, just had a few bites of bitter cucumber. But the tomatoes were really fresh. The pizza was great. Homemade dough and was cooked to perfection. We were the only ones in the dining room. But it was a nice establishment. Would love to go back and try the Mexican menu.

    Pizzeoli sits in historic Soulard and feels like a restored, cozy little pizzeria with dark…read moremulti-colored lights, a soundtrack that drifts between 1920s/30s jazz and the occasional pop or mid-century tune, and a wood-burning oven as the literal and figurative center of gravity. There's a charming patio out front, if you want it. You can settle in for a long dinner, post up at the bar for the night, or grab a quick bite before heading out on the town. Bartenders are warm and approachable, and the in-house mixology is confident without any "we spent 30 hours perfecting this" pretense. The whole experience is like Sam Malone the bartender (save the drama) at Cheers: friendly, self-assured, the kind of place that makes you feel like you could spend all night there without anyone rushing you. We had a Paper Plane and an Old Fashioned -- the latter served over a custom ice cube stamped with a double ax (a nod to the wood fire). The cocktail list leans classic and reliable: if you know you like gin or vodka, you'll find something easy here. The espresso martini is the standout, it works as a dessert drink or any other time of the meal. We started with the Smorgasbord instead of our usual garlic knots (which are their own delicacy), and it didn't disappoint: toasted brioche with mascarpone and strawberry jam, several cured meats (capicola, prosciutto, pepperoni), parmesan, gouda, dried cherries, and chutney. My one nitpick; the pepperoni and gouda were tiny cubes, which makes them tough to grab cleanly compared to the sliced parmesan or rolled prosciutto. In this situation give the man a toothpick. The tallow-fried wings are, in my opinion, the best in St. Louis. The beef-tallow-and-potato-starch breading produces a tempura-like texture and crunch that keeps them light. Adventurous-but-classic sauces, bourbon butter BBQ, buffalo, and pineapple honey habanero (legitimately spicy; bring backup). The wings stand on their own without sauce. For pizza, we got the Napoli (tomato, fresh and smoked mozzarella, arugula, parmesan, black pepper, olive oil) -- her standing favorite. Expect proper Neapolitan: soft center, thin crust, charred crisp edge. Don't lift and bite fold it. (She insists: no fork. I use a fork - I know how dare I!) The pizza menu reads creative but never gimmicky; meat-lovers, vegetarians, vegans, and gluten-conscious diners all have real options. Before Kyle took over, Pizzeoli was known as a vegan-forward spot, and that flexibility lives on. We closed with the seasonal ice cream sandwich, fresh-pressed pizzelle wafers, crème brûlée ice cream, and a torched marshmallow cap. Excellent. A couple of practical notes: they're dinner-only (4-9:30) and the new reservation phone line is a robo call. Easier to use the online waitlist or book online directly.
